Output e5d286236b5b43bf75f9ec6012c7d472c6715be33a74978e9f449017b543b5fd:0

value
2521900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cabc7dbeaa2ac2b492ad6235220f2552b67c0cd OP_EQUAL
address
35mDSWus6fXVRo1qRiaWKpvy61Dfw9yzTZ
transaction
e5d286236b5b43bf75f9ec6012c7d472c6715be33a74978e9f449017b543b5fd
spent
true